Premier Assistive Technology has created a wide
assortment of tools that make your computer read to you. This is a powerful tool for people who
struggle with writing, reading and/or spelling.
The Lambton-Kent District School
Board has now made these programs available for you to use at home.
Have your computer read your favorite web page,
email, home work, or even read a book. There is even a program on this site
that will let you convert your documents into audio files so you can listen to
them on an MP3 player! These tools are also great for proofreading and editing
your homework.

Minimum System
Requirements
· Microsoft Windows 2000 or XP
· 256 MB of RAM
· 200 MB of free disk space
· Mouse, Keyboard Speakers
· SVGA Monitor with a minimum 800x600 DPI resolution
A scanner is only a requirement if you wish to
convert hardcopy documents (i.e. books, magazines, letters) into digital text.
Scan and Read Pro and Universal ReaderPlus are the only tools that use a scanner.
They work with most flat bed scanners. The recommended scanners are those from Epson,
Visioneer, or Canon.
